Output 269a71ab54c498619170d317998861e36fba2f97a0a20c804b85e4d4a590bb0e:0

value
655358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7a90b14c66337d3ff2e81064284f5ae16226ec4 OP_EQUAL
address
3GyXGuu3BW6hVW1hYFFeWg7njqMV9vEGfm
transaction
269a71ab54c498619170d317998861e36fba2f97a0a20c804b85e4d4a590bb0e
spent
true